2 Connection methods

Let’s first look at how the two connect to the database:

Copy code The code is as follows:

// PDO
$pdo = new PDO("mysql:host=localhost;dbname=database", 'username', 'password');
// mysqli, process-oriented approach
$mysqli = mysqli_connect('localhost','username','password','database');
// mysqli, object-oriented
$mysqli = new mysqli('localhost','username','password','database');

3 database support

PDO supports multiple databases, but MYSQLI only supports MYSQL

4 named parameter name parameter

PDO method:

Copy code The code is as follows:

$params = array(':username' => 'test', ':email' => $mail, ':last_login' => time() - 3600);
$pdo->prepare('
SELECT * FROM users
WHERE username = :username
AND email = :email
AND last_login > :last_login');

But MYSQLI is a bit more troublesome. It does not support this, so it can only:

Copy code The code is as follows:

$query = $mysqli->prepare('
SELECT * FROM users
WHERE username = ?
AND email = ?
AND last_login > ?');
$query->bind_param('sss', 'test', $mail, time() - 3600);
$query->execute();

In this case, it would be troublesome and inconvenient to order the question marks one by one.

5 ORM mapping support

For example, there is a class user, as follows:

Copy code The code is as follows:

class User
{
Public $id;
Public $first_name;
Public $last_name;
Public function info()
{
              return '#' . $this->id . ': ' . $this->first_name . ' ' . $this->last_name;
}
}
$query = "SELECT id, first_name, last_name FROM users";
// PDO
$result = $pdo->query($query);
$result->setFetchMode(PDO::FETCH_CLASS, 'User');
while ($user = $result->fetch())
{
echo $user->info() . "n";
}

MYSQLI uses a process-oriented approach:

Copy code The code is as follows:

if ($result = mysqli_query($mysqli, $query)) {
​while ($user = mysqli_fetch_object($result, 'User')) {
echo $user->info()."n";
}
}

MYSQLI adopts a process-oriented approach:

Copy code The code is as follows:

// MySQLi, object oriented way
if ($result = $mysqli->query($query)) {
​while ($user = $result->fetch_object('User')) {
echo $user->info()."n";
}
}

6 Preventing SQL injection:

PDO Manual Settings

Copy code The code is as follows:

$username = PDO::quote($_GET['username']);
$pdo->query("SELECT * FROM users WHERE username = $username");

Use mysqli

Copy code The code is as follows:

$username = mysqli_real_escape_string($_GET['username']);
$mysqli->query("SELECT * FROM users WHERE username = '$username'");

7 preparestament

PDO method:

Copy code The code is as follows:

$pdo->prepare('SELECT * FROM users WHERE username = :username');
$pdo->execute(array(':username' => $_GET['username']));

MYSQLI:

Copy code The code is as follows:

$query = $mysqli->prepare('SELECT * FROM users WHERE username = ?');
$query->bind_param('s', $_GET['username']);
$query->execute();
